**Vendor note: Inkmill markdown pipeline**

Rendering for Parchway docs is outsourced to Inkmill under an annual contract, renewing each March. They handle sanitization and PDF export; we own the upload queue. SLA: 4-hour response on rendering failures. Escalate only after two failed retries. Their support desk is reachable at the address below.

billing contact of hahaf-baguf = zorael.tammir.jorius@sivrelhq.internal

**Ticket PKG-4412: Typoscan flags its own mirror packages**

Repro steps:
1. Point your plugin at the Glintworks staging registry.
2. Run a scan against the `fernlib` namespace.
3. Typoscan reports `fernlib-mirror` as a squat, which is ours.

Expected: mirror allowlist respected. Actual: false positive every run. To reproduce against staging, authenticate with the token below.

session JWT of yawep-yawep = eyJhbGciOiJIUzI1NiIsInR5cCI6IkpXVCJ9.eyJzdWIiOiI3pWF3_In0.aXYsHiog

Hi — quick handover before I'm off. The evacuation-chair store is the grey cupboard by the Stairwell B landing on floor 3, next to the Pellworth Room. Two chairs inside; the straps on the older one are stiff, so newbies should practise with the blue one first. Check the log sheet weekly. The cupboard lock takes the code below.

turnstile pass: bdg-FVNQRS-72965873

Finance Review Summary — Joint Venture Proposal

For branch managers: Halden Mercantile has completed its initial review of the proposed venture with Torbay Instruments. Projected capital contribution is within approved limits, and modeled payback falls inside four years. Currency exposure is modest. Legal diligence continues through month-end; branch input on regional demand is due beforehand. The rationale connects to the confidential planning note that follows below.

internal memo for hahif-hahaf: Headcount on the Zorwyn team goes from 9 to 100 by the end of October. Gross margin on Zorwyn came in at 5 percent against a plan of 10 percent.